生命在于运动,老鼠也爱奔跑

2014-09-05来源:和谐英语

If an exercise wheel sits in a forest, will mice run on it?
如果把跑轮放在森林里,小鼠会上去跑步吗?

Every once in a while, science asks a simple question and gets a straightforward answer.
科学时常会提出一个简单的问题,然后得到一个直截了当的答案。

In this case, yes, they will. And not only mice, but also rats, shrews, frogs and slugs.
这个问题的答案是,会。不仅小鼠会,大鼠、鼩鼱、青蛙和蛞蝓都会。

True, the frogs did not exactly run, and the slugs probably ended up on the wheel by accident, but the mice clearly enjoyed it. That, scientists said, means that wheel-running is not a neurotic behavior found only in caged mice.
当然,青蛙算不上在跑,蛞蝓可能也是偶然来到跑轮上的,但是小鼠明显是真的喜欢跑轮。科学家表示,这说明在跑轮上跑步并不是关在笼子里的老鼠才有的神经性举动。

They like the wheel.
它们喜欢跑轮。

Two researchers in the Netherlands did an experiment that it seems nobody had tried before. They placed exercise wheels outdoors in a yard garden and in an area of dunes, and monitored the wheels with motion detectors and automatic cameras.
荷兰的两名研究员做了一项似乎从来没人做过的实验。他们在室外的院子和一块沙地里放置了一些跑轮,并通过运动检测器和自动相机对这些跑轮进行监测。

They were inspired by questions from animal welfare committees at universities about whether mice were really enjoying wheel-running, an activity used in all sorts of studies, or were instead like bears pacing in a cage, stressed and neurotic. Would they run on a wheel if they were free?
他们的灵感来自一些大学的动物福利委员会所提出的问题。这些委员会质疑小鼠是否真的喜欢在轮子上跑步——所有研究都会用到这个活动,或者还是像在笼子里踱步的熊那样,出于压力和紧张。如果处于自由状态,它们还会在轮子上跑步吗?

Now there is no doubt. Mice came to the wheels like human beings to a health club holding a spring membership sale. They made the wheels spin. They hopped on, hopped off and hopped back on.
目前,这一点毫无疑问。到跑轮上跑步的小鼠,就像来到正在举行春季促销的健身俱乐部的人类一样。他们开始让轮子转动。它们跳上去、跳下来,然后再跳上去。

"When I saw the first mice, I was extremely happy," said Johanna H. Meijer at Leiden University Medical Center in the Netherlands. "I had to laugh about the results, but at the same time, I take it very seriously. It's funny, and it's important at the same time."
“当我看见第一只小鼠时,我非常高兴,”荷兰莱顿大学医学中心(Leiden University Medical Center)的约翰娜·H·梅杰(Johanna H. Meijer)说。“这些结果不能不让我觉得可笑,但同时,我也会认真对待它。这很有趣,同时也很重要。”

Dr. Meijer's day job is as a "brain electrophysiologist" studying biological rhythms in mice. She relished the chance to get out of the laboratory and study wild animals, and in a way that no one else had.
梅杰的正职工作是研究小鼠生物节律的“脑电生理学家”。她非常享受走出实验室,以前所未有的方式研究野生动物的机会。

She said Konrad Lorenz, the great-grandfather of animal behavior studies, once mentioned in a letter that some of his caged rats had escaped and then returned to his garden to use running wheels placed there.
她说,动物行为研究的鼻祖康拉德·洛伦茨(Konrad Lorenz)曾在一封信中提到,有些被他关在笼子里的大鼠逃走后,又回到他的花园,到放在那里的跑轮上跑步。

But, Dr. Meijer said, the Lorenz observation "was one sentence."
但是,梅杰说,洛伦茨的观察“只是一句话”。
